Ticket: Mail room relocation — Pennard Wharf

Hi reception folks,

The mail room moves from the ground floor to basement level B1 this Friday. Couriers should be pointed to the new hatch by the goods entrance from Monday — signs are going up Thursday. Undelivered parcels will sit in the old room until Wednesday, so you may need to fetch stragglers. The old room stays locked; to retrieve anything, use the door code below.

turnstile pass: bdg-FVNQRS-72965873

1. Expansion into the Caldria region approved in principle. Site scouting begins next month; two distribution hubs proposed near Westhollow.
2. Staffing: initial team of 14, drawn partly from the Ridgemont office.
3. Budget: capital envelope confirmed; contingency held centrally.
4. Risks: regulatory timelines and cold-chain logistics flagged; mitigation owners assigned.

Next review in six weeks. The strategic rationale for sequencing Caldria ahead of other regions is recorded in the confidential note below.

management briefing: Project Ulavan slips by two quarters because of the staffing delay.

New folks: read this before touching the export pipeline. Staging and prod disagree on retry behavior for failed exports. Prod got a hand-edit during the Febric outage (retry cap raised, backoff shortened) and it was never committed back. Result: prod hammers the downstream warehouse on partial failures; staging gives up too early. Fix is to reconcile both environments to the reviewed baseline and lock edits behind the config pipeline. The agreed baseline values to apply are below.

config for tagep-yajef:
ulawyn:
  log_level: error
  metrics_host: metrics.ulawyn.lumiclabs.internal
  pin: 0564
  pool_size: 32

For the board. Recommendation: proceed with phased entry into the Dorvan Coast. Market sizing by Ilka Renn supports a two-branch launch; payback modelled at 26 months. Key risks: local licensing lag and a single incumbent, Torvek Supply, with strong distributor ties. Mitigations drafted. Capital ask is within the approved envelope; no additional debt required. Hiring plan covers twelve roles in year one. Legal review is complete. Decision requested at this session. The confidential strategic note follows directly below.

confidential, kagup-bafog: Fraaxax Group is in early talks to buy Soroxox Group for about $343.8 million. The Olidor launch date is June 14, and nothing goes to the press before then. Legal wants the Aldmirek Logistics term sheet signed before July 23.